How much do java mainframe j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for java mainframe in Florida is $39.89,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$35.19 and $45.29 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Java Mainframe job?

A Java Mainframe job involves developing, maintaining, and optimizing applications that run on mainframe systems using Java and related technologies. Professionals in this role work with legacy systems, integrating modern Java-based applications with COBOL, DB2, CICS, and other mainframe technologies. They often focus on performance tuning, debugging, and ensuring seamless interaction between mainframe and distributed systems. This role requires expertise in both Java programming and mainframe architectures.

Can Java run on a mainframe?

Java Mainframe developers work with Java applications on mainframe systems, which often run z/OS or similar environments. Java can run on mainframes using specialized runtime environments like IBM's Java Virtual Machine, enabling integration with legacy mainframe applications and tools. Knowledge of mainframe architecture and Java development is essential for this role.
